Special Features & Unique Opportunities
The Wausau Family Medicine offers rigorous unopposed broad-spectrum training through a large hospital network in a welcoming community, which includes extensive recreational opportunities. We have dedicated faculty, a diverse population, work-life balance and patient centered care in state-of-the-art facilities. We offer 4 specialized rotation tracks, in addition to embedded OMT, Addiction and GAC clinics. Graduates are well prepared and successful in outpatient and hospital medicine.
